
VMware通过其强大的虚拟化能力,使用户能够在一台物理机上运行多个操作系统,从而极大地提高了资源利用率和灵活性
而在VMware虚拟机中配置网络,尤其是使用NAT(网络地址转换)模式上网,是实现虚拟机与宿主机及外部网络高效通信的重要一环
本文将深入探讨VMware NAT上网的原理、配置步骤、优势及应用场景,帮助读者掌握这一关键技能
一、VMware NAT上网原理概述 VMware提供了三种主要的网络连接模式:桥接(Bridged)、NAT(Network Address Translation)和主机(Host-Only)
其中,NAT模式因其灵活性和安全性,成为许多用户的首选
NAT模式的基本原理是,VMware Workstation或VMware ESXi等虚拟化平台会在宿主机上创建一个虚拟NAT设备和一个虚拟DHCP服务器
虚拟机通过虚拟NAT设备与宿主机相连,而宿主机则作为网关,负责将虚拟机发出的网络请求转换为宿主机自身的IP地址后再发送到外部网络
外部网络返回的数据包则通过相反的路径,经NAT设备转换后,再送达对应的虚拟机
这一过程不仅实现了虚拟机与外部网络的通信,还有效隐藏了虚拟机的真实IP地址,增强了安全性
二、VMware NAT上网配置步骤 配置VMware虚拟机使用NAT模式上网,通常包括以下几个步骤: 1.检查宿主机网络设置: 确保宿主机已连接到互联网,并能正常访问外部网络
这是配置NAT模式的前提
2.打开VMware虚拟机设置: 在VMware Workstation或VMware Fusion中,选中目标虚拟机,点击“编辑虚拟机设置”或“Settings”
3.配置网络适配器: 在网络适配器选项中,选择“NAT”作为网络连接类型
这一步会自动配置虚拟机使用由VMware管理的虚拟NAT设备和DHCP服务
4.启动虚拟机: 启动配置好的虚拟机,操作系统将自动通过DHCP获取一个由VMware虚拟DHCP服务器分配的IP地址
5.验证网络连接: 在虚拟机中打开浏览器或其他网络工具,尝试访问外部网站或服务,以验证NAT配置是否成功
三、VMware NAT上网的优势 1.简化网络配置: NAT模式避免了手动配置静态IP地址和路由规则的复杂性,特别适合需要频繁更换网络环境或测试不同网络配置的场景
2.提高安全性: 通过NAT,虚拟机与外部网络之间的直接通信被限制,有效防止了潜在的外部攻击,为虚拟机提供了一个相对安全的网络环境
3.资源利用最大化: 在NAT模式下,多个虚拟机可以共享宿主机的一个物理网络接口,这对于资源有限的个人用户或小型团队来说,可以显著提高网络资源的利用效率
4.便于网络隔离与测试: NAT模式允许在不影响宿主机网络配置的情况下,对虚拟机进行独立的网络测试和调整,非常适合开发和测试环境
四、VMware NAT上网的应用场景 1.软件开发与测试: 在软件开发过程中,开发者经常需要在不同操作系统或配置环境下测试应用程序
NAT模式使得虚拟机能够轻松访问互联网,下载必要的软件或库文件,同时保持与宿主机网络的相对隔离,避免干扰
2.网络安全与渗透测试: 网络安全专业人员利用NAT模式创建多个虚拟机,模拟不同的攻击场景和目标环境,进行渗透测试和安全评估,而无需担心这些活动会影响到实际的生产网络
3.教育与培训: 在教育机构中,NAT模式允许学生在虚拟机上自由探索网络配置、服务搭建等实验,而不必担心对校园网络造成不良影响
4.家庭和小型企业网络: 对于家庭和小型企业用户,NAT模式提供了一种经济高效的方式,让多台虚拟机共享有限的网络带宽和IP资源,满足学习、办公和娱乐的多样化需求
五、常见问题与解决方案 尽管VMware NAT模式提供了诸多便利,但在实际应用中,用户可能会遇到一些常见问题,如虚拟机无法访问外部网络、网络连接不稳定等
以下是一些常见的故障排除方法: - 检查VMware网络服务:确保VMware的NAT服务和DHCP服务都已启动并运行正常
- 检查防火墙设置:有时,宿主机的防火墙或安全软件可能会阻止虚拟机的网络流量
检查并适当调整防火墙规则
- 重启网络服务:有时,重启VMware的网络服务或宿主机本身可以解决网络连接问题
- 查看虚拟机日志:通过分析虚拟机的日志文件,可以找到网络配置错误的线索
- 更新VMware软件:确保使用的是最新版本的VMware软件,因为新版本可能修复了旧版本中的已知问题
六、结语 VMware NAT上网作为虚拟化技术中不可或缺的一部分,以其高效、灵活、安全的特性,广泛应用于软件开发、网络安全测试、教育培训以及家庭和小型企业等多个领域
掌握VMware NAT的配置与优化技巧,对于提升工作效率、保障网络安全、促进技术创新具有重要意义
希望本文能够帮助读者深入理解VMware NAT上网的原理与操作,为构建高效、安全的虚拟网络环境打下坚实的基础
虚拟机安装盗版Win10:合法性与风险探讨
VMware NAT设置,轻松实现虚拟机上网
掌握VMware NSX许可证,优化虚拟化部署
Win7虚拟机如何访问Win10硬盘秘籍
掌握nuc虚拟机管理器:高效管理虚拟环境的秘诀
VMware虚拟机开机不自启解决方案
VMware虚拟机运行Java程序指南
掌握VMware NSX许可证,优化虚拟化部署
VMware虚拟机开机不自启解决方案
VMware虚拟机运行Java程序指南
VMware路由配置全攻略
VMware官方注册指南精简版
VMware虚拟机补丁:安全升级指南
Win10适配:优选VMware版本指南
VMware VIClient:高效管理虚拟机神器
VMware设置系统全屏教程
加速攻略!解决VMware下载缓慢问题
VMware多ISO文件高效下载指南
VMware路由设置全攻略